Band 6+: The table below shows the sales at a small restaurant in a downtown business district. Summarize the information by selecting and reporting the main features, and make comparisons where relevant.

This report will describe a table illustrating the sale numbers in a restaurant categorized by lunch and dinner during the days of a typical week of the October.

Overall, it can be clearly seen that customers mostly spent money on dinner in this restaurant, additionally, the sale number is lower in the weekends.

First of all, dinner foods shared the highest amount of earnings, which was approximately above 3,500 dollars in the week days; however, it reached its peak at Friday, with 4,350 dollars. By contrast, the amount of money which earned from lunch sales was noticeably lower than that of dinner.(averaged between 2,400 and 2,595 bucks during the week days).

On the weekends, both sales of dinner and lunch experienced a decrease on amount, in Saturday with 1,950 and just below 3,000 for lunch and dinner, respectively. In addition, they touched their lowest amount on Sunday, with 1,550 dollars for lunch, and 2,450 bucks for dinner.
